Sutton is a great prospect. He is a very likely commit. He is just taking his time. Sutton had a great visit and visited at the same time as Chase Pine, another great LB prospect, who is a soft verbal to Pitt. Sutton and Pine hit it off on their visit to ISU and the prospect of playing together and being the "Bruise Brothers" is very appealing. Pine has a visit to Pitt in mid-January. And will likely make a decision after that.

Sutton is almost certain to commit. Pine is a maybe. But we have a very good shot. Getting both of them would be absolutely huge. Very good LB prospects.
